QUESTION 1
A Cohesity installation engineer is racking two physical nodes in a new cluster. The

nodes are connected to two separate top-of-rack switches for redundancy. Which
network bonding mode should be configured on each node to provide both link

aggregation and failover when the switches support LACP?
A) Active-Backup

B) Balance-rr
C) 802.3ad (LACP)

D) Balance-alb
CORRECT ANSWER: C

EXPERT RATIONALE: 802.3ad (LACP) provides aggregated bandwidth and link-level
failover when connected to switches that support Link Aggregation Control Protocol.
Active-Backup provides only failover without aggregation.

QUESTION 2

An engineer is performing the initial setup of a Cohesity cluster using the CLI-based
node configuration wizard. Which two network parameters are mandatory when

assigning a static IP to a node? (Choose two.)
A) VLAN ID

B) Subnet mask
C) Default gateway

D) DNS search domain
E) Bond interface name

CORRECT ANSWER: B, C
EXPERT RATIONALE: A static IP assignment requires at minimum the IP address, subnet

mask, and default gateway to establish basic IP connectivity. VLAN ID and bond name
are layer 2 parameters defined separately.


QUESTION 3
A Cohesity administrator needs to join a new cluster to an Active Directory domain for

user authentication. Which type of Cohesity resource must be created first to enable AD
integration?

A) Protection Group
B) Storage Domain

C) View
D) Authentication Provider

CORRECT ANSWER: D
EXPERT RATIONALE: An Authentication Provider object defines the connection

parameters (domain, credentials) for Active Directory or LDAP integration. Views and
Protection Groups are independent of directory services setup.

QUESTION 4

During a Cohesity node replacement, the administrator physically inserts the
replacement node. What must be done from the Cohesity UI to add this node back into

the cluster?
A) Run the “Replace Node” workflow under Hardware

B) Reboot all nodes in the cluster
C) Run the “Add Node” wizard and enter the replacement node's serial number

D) Manually configure the node’s IP from the node console
CORRECT ANSWER: A

EXPERT RATIONALE: The Hardware section provides a guided “Replace Node” workflow
that removes the failed node’s metadata and accepts the replacement chassis. A simple

add node wizard is used for expanding a cluster, not for replacing a failed node in-place.

QUESTION 5

A Cohesity cluster is configured with an External Target pointing to an AWS S3 bucket
for archival. The cloud credentials have rotated. Where should the administrator update

the new access key and secret key?
A) In the Protection Policy’s archive settings

B) Under Sources > Registration
C) In the External Target properties

D) In the Storage Domain’s cloud tier configuration
CORRECT ANSWER: C

EXPERT RATIONALE: External Targets store cloud provider credentials. Updating them in
the target’s configuration applies immediately to all archival jobs using that target.

QUESTION 7
The cluster status shows “Warning” for a node with a degraded disk. What is the

immediate recommended action to restore data resiliency?
A) Immediately remove the node from the cluster

B) Replace the faulty disk and wait for automatic rebalance
C) Shut down the node to preserve data

D) Disable erasure coding for all Storage Domains
CORRECT ANSWER: B

EXPERT RATIONALE: Cohesity’s distributed filesystem automatically re-replicates and
rebalances data after a failed disk is replaced. Removing the node would cause

unnecessary data loss.
